The bias voltage source must have low resistance and be able to supply the grid current. When tubes designed for class B are employed, the bias can be as little as zero. Class C amplifiers are biased negatively at a point well beyond plate current cutoff. WebMar 20, 2012 · Mar 19, 2012. #3. The type of input transistors (NPN or PNP) determines which direction the input bias current flows. Most opamps use NPN input transistors but a few like the LM358 and LM324 use PNP. Some opamps use Jafet or Mosfet input transistors that have no input bias current. J.
